Conversion Table

In a RGB color space, hex #d4d1d9 is made of 33% red, 33% green and 34% blue. In a HSL mode Spooky Ghost has a hue angle of 262.5°, a saturation of 9.52% and a lightness of 83.53%. In a CMYK space (used in printing only), hex #d4d1d9 is made of 1.96% cyan, 3.14% magenta, 0% yellow and 14.9% black ink.

HEX #d4d1d9
RGB Decimal rgb(212,209,217)
RGB Percentage 33%, 33%, 34%
CMYK 1.96, 3.14, 0, 14.9
HSL hsl(262.5,9.52%,83.53%)
HSV (or HSB) hsv(262.5,3.69%,85.1%)
CIE-LAB lab(84.2812,2.4927,-3.5923)
XYZ xyz(62.4762,64.6077,74.8233)
